中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

如何使用Verilog進行調試和錯誤定位

發布時間:2024-04-23 16:56:39 來源:億速云 閱讀:104 作者:小樊 欄目:編程語言

Verilog作為硬件描述語言,通常用于設計和仿真數字電路。在Verilog調試和錯誤定位過程中,可以采取以下幾種方法:

  1. 使用仿真工具進行波形調試:通過仿真工具(如ModelSim、VCS等)查看和分析波形來驗證設計的正確性。可以逐步檢查輸入輸出信號、寄存器狀態和時序關系,以定位問題所在。

  2. 添加測試點和斷言:在設計中添加測試點和斷言來驗證設計的正確性。測試點是指特定的信號或狀態,用于檢查設計在某些條件下的正確性;斷言是一種形式化的描述,用于描述設計的行為和屬性,可以幫助定位錯誤。

  3. 使用調試工具:一些仿真工具提供了調試功能,可以設置斷點、單步執行、查看變量值等操作來幫助調試設計。

  4. 進行設計分析:通過靜態分析工具對設計進行分析,查找潛在的問題和錯誤。例如,使用Lint工具檢查語法錯誤、未使用的信號、未初始化的變量等。

  5. 與硬件調試工具結合:有些仿真工具可以與硬件調試工具(如邏輯分析儀、示波器)結合使用,可以實時監控硬件信號,幫助定位設計中的問題。

總的來說,Verilog調試和錯誤定位需要結合多種方法和工具,通過不斷的驗證、分析和檢查,逐步定位和解決設計中的問題。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

灵山县| 烟台市| 马公市| 射洪县| 逊克县| 潍坊市| 旌德县| 根河市| 阿鲁科尔沁旗| 弋阳县| 东平县| 宿迁市| 平泉县| 石景山区| 琼结县| 徐汇区| 兴安盟| 贡觉县| 盐源县| 灵璧县| 甘泉县| 新巴尔虎左旗| 专栏| 松溪县| 蓬安县| 平山县| 连南| 额济纳旗| 罗定市| 南丹县| 岐山县| 青河县| 河津市| 平遥县| 莎车县| 托克逊县| 喀什市| 永善县| 双流县| 会东县| 苍山县|